Why is there so much fascination with this specific font style? Because Neethane En Ponvasantham was a paradox. Despite a lukewarm box office performance, its title card became a design benchmark. It proved that a Tamil film title didn't need gold gradients or exploding stars. A clean, well-kerned, soft-rounded font on a blurry background could convey more emotion than any 3D render.
The title logo of Neethane En Ponvasantham (which translates to You Are My Golden Springtime ) perfectly mirrors the film's themes of enduring love, nostalgia, and emotional maturity.

The title font for Neethaane En Ponvasantham (NEP) is more than just a label; it is a visual extension of director Gautham Vasudev Menon’s signature "urban-romantic" aesthetic. The typography plays a critical role in establishing the film’s tone—nostalgic, sophisticated, and deeply personal.
